一 什么是跨域 跨域 指的是瀏覽器不能執行其他網站的腳本。它是由瀏覽器的同源策略造成的,是瀏覽器對javascript施加的安全限制。 同源策略 是指協議,域名,端口都要相同,其中有一個不同都會產生跨域,在請求數據時,瀏覽器會在控制臺中報一個異常,提示拒絕訪問。
vue使用axios調用接口,解決跨域
vue使用axios調用接口,解決跨域 2259 人閱讀 2020/7/8 11:36 總訪問: 513969 評論:12 手機 收藏 分類: 前端 一.先下載axios依賴 npm install axios 二.在需要的地方引入 import axios from ‘axios’ 三.環境準備好了之后就可以使用axios調用接口了
用elementUI搭建后臺界面;不錯的選擇;配合vue,這里不得不說跨域調試;目前webpack是時下流行的打包工具。也叫前端自動化解決方案;第一個坑就是:修改了js記得重新編譯下;之前遇到一個問題相同的http請求axios為什么獲取不到data數據。
1, 跨域配置指的是在本地運行npm環境中跨域,在打包后還是需要服務器的支持和后端支持,直接打包上下并不會跨域。 2, 在配置多個跨域時請注意首位名字必須一致。 例子: 基于EuiAdmin+axios實現跨域與酷我音樂進行交互,實現音樂播放器例子:
將host和port直接配置進url。但會有跨域問題。 2,將axios請求攔截,代理到後端指定地址 這個就是在vue.config.js中進行配置,通過target 和pathRewrite來重寫訪問後端的路徑,這樣在前端看不出來後端的實際訪問地址。 proxy: {[process. env.
axios 中的跨域問題不是很懂。
axios 中的跨域問題不是很懂。 ximikang · 4 天前 · 573 次點擊 現在遇到的問題是,需要使用一個其他網頁中的接口,使用 nodejs 中的 axios 可以直接訪問接口和數據,但是在我自己的前端網頁中使用相同的代碼使用 axios 請求一直遇到了跨域問題。
參考文章: 1.如何解決出現AXIOS的Request header field Content-Type is not allowed by Access-Control-Allow-Headers in preflight response 2.跨域問題服務端解決辦法 Request header field Authorization is not allowed by Access-Control-Allow-Headers 3.ajax跨域post提交json字符串報錯Request header field Content-Type is not allowed by Access-Control-Allow-Header
一 什么是跨域 跨域 指的是瀏覽器不能執行其他網站的腳本。它是由瀏覽器的同源策略造成的,是瀏覽器對javascript施加的安全限制。 同源策略 是指協議,域名,端口都要相同,其中有一個不同都會產生跨域,在請求數據時,瀏覽器會在控制臺中報一個異常,提示拒絕訪問。
axios解決跨域訪問 內容簡介 多米 {follow498587972 ? ‘已關注’ : ‘關注’} {fansNum498587972} 2018年01月18日發布 相關視頻 換一換 1-16 axios post請求 1-24 路由高亮效果 01 js初識
一篇文章實現Vue集成Axios,調用,跨域,配置多個跨域 …
31/12/2020 · 1, 跨域配置指的是在本地運行npm環境中跨域,在打包后還是需要服務器的支持和后端支持,直接打包上下并不會跨域。 2, 在配置多個跨域時請注意首位名字必須一致。 例子: 基于EuiAdmin+axios實現跨域與酷我音樂進行交互,實現音樂播放器例子: 總結:
vue中axios解決跨域問題和攔截器的使用方法 vue中axios不支持vue.use()方式聲明使用. 所以有兩種方法可以解決這點: 第一種: 在main.js中引入axios,然后將其設置為vue原型鏈上的屬性,這樣在組件中就可以直接 this.axios使用了 import axios from ‘axios’; Vue
今天的問題是幫同事看的,簡單的post請求卻得不到返回值,跨域而且看network的時候,request mothod:options,都以為是請求寫的不對 后面看代碼的時候發現因為單點登錄,對axios進行了攔截封裝,其中 axios.defau…
參考文章: 1.如何解決出現AXIOS的Request header field Content-Type is not allowed by Access-Control-Allow-Headers in preflight response 2.跨域問題服務端解決辦法 Request header field Authorization is not allowed by Access-Control-Allow-Headers 3.ajax跨域post提交json字符串報錯Request header field Content-Type is not allowed by Access-Control-Allow-Header
axios跨域訪問js端配置
由于vue2.0官方選擇axios來完成 ajax 請求,所以我最近開始用axios寫ajax的請求操作。我之前用的架構都是前后端分離,所以必然存在跨域問題。我根據github上axios的官方文檔,寫了post請求方法,可惜瀏 …
猜您在找 利用axios解決跨域的問題 Vue使用Axios實現http請求以及解決跨域問題 vue項目中解決跨域問題axios和 vue-cli3 axios解決跨域問題 axios實現跨域的問題 vue實現跨域 vue2.0–axios的跨域問題 什么是跨域?
工作中遇到的一個axios跨域請求問題,記錄下最終的解決方法。 問題描述 前端用Vue,引入了axios,調用的是rails項目中的接口。vue 2.5.17 , rails 5.2.1 Vue項目中,配置文件含如下內容:
文章目錄常見配置選項實際項目中的簡化寫法并發請求多個請求接口實際項目生命周期中使用axios 數據存入data()模塊封裝攔截器axios的post的請求頭Content-Typeaxios 全局配置接口函數的封裝配置設置代理解決請求跨域vue前端跨域 axios : 基于http客戶端的
Axios跨域處理方案
Axios跨域 處理方案 生產與開發環境都配置完成了,開發環境可直接進行跨域請求,生產環境還需要后端進行配合處理 程序員不務正業 【思考】為何棄用jQuery?(上
自從入了 Vue 之后,一直在用 axios 這個庫來做一些異步請求。下面這篇文章主要給大家介紹了關于axios中cookie跨域及相關配置的相關資料,文中通過示例代碼介紹的非常詳細,需要的朋友可以參考借鑒,下面隨著小編來一起看看吧。
文章目錄常見配置選項實際項目中的簡化寫法并發請求多個請求接口實際項目生命周期中使用axios 數據存入data()模塊封裝攔截器axios的post的請求頭Content-Typeaxios 全局配置接口函數的封裝配置設置代理解決請求跨域vue前端跨域 axios : 基于http客戶端的
工作中遇到的一個axios跨域請求問題,記錄下最終的解決方法。 問題描述 前端用Vue,引入了axios,調用的是rails項目中的接口。vue 2.5.17 , rails 5.2.1 Vue項目中,配置文件含如下內容:
解決vue axios跨域 Request Method: OPTIONS問題(預檢 …
我們在vue開發中用axios進行跨域請求時有時會遇到,同一個接口請求了兩次,并且第一次都是options請求,然后才是post/get請求 如下圖 options請求 get請求 為什么會出現這種原因呢? 這是因為CORS跨域分為 簡單跨域請求和復雜跨域請求;
三,axios傳參 1:Vue官方推薦組件axios默認就是提交 JSON 字符串,所以我們要以json字符串直接拼接在url后面的形式,直接將json對象傳進去就行了 let postData = { companyCode:’tur’, userName:’123456789123456789’, password:’123456′}
axios默認是沒有jsonp 跨域請求的方法的。一般來說流行的做法是將跨域放在后臺來解決,也就是后臺開發人員添加跨域頭信息。本文主要為大家詳細介紹了vue使用axios跨域請求數據的問題,具有一定的參考價值,感興趣的小伙伴們可以參考一下,希望能幫助到大家。